Key Insights
The global Ophthalmic Lasers Industry is poised for robust expansion, currently valued at approximately 1.49 billion USD in 2025. This growth is driven by a projected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 4.70% over the forecast period of 2025-2033. Key drivers fueling this upward trajectory include the increasing prevalence of eye diseases such as glaucoma, cataracts, diabetic retinopathy, and the growing demand for refractive error correction procedures. Advances in laser technology, leading to more precise, less invasive, and effective treatments, are also significant contributors. The expanding elderly population worldwide, a demographic more susceptible to age-related vision conditions, further bolsters market demand. Furthermore, rising healthcare expenditures and greater accessibility to advanced ophthalmic treatments in emerging economies are creating substantial opportunities for market players.

Product Segments:
- Femtosecond Lasers: These lasers are witnessing substantial growth due to their precision in cataract surgery (e.g., femtosecond laser-assisted cataract surgery - FLACS) and refractive error corrections, offering flapless LASIK procedures and improved visual outcomes.
- Diode Lasers: Essential for treating diabetic retinopathy, glaucoma (e.g., transscleral cyclophotocoagulation), and retinal vascular diseases, diode lasers represent a stable and growing segment due to the rising incidence of these conditions.
- Excimer Lasers: While a mature technology, excimer lasers continue to be vital for wavefront-guided LASIK and PRK procedures, catering to a consistent demand for refractive error corrections.
- Nd:YAG Lasers: Crucial for posterior capsulotomy following cataract surgery and iridotomy for angle-closure glaucoma, Nd:YAG lasers maintain their importance in addressing specific post-surgical complications and certain glaucoma types.
Application Segments:
- Cataract Removal: This remains the largest application segment, propelled by the global aging population and the increasing adoption of femtosecond laser-assisted cataract surgery.
- Refractive Error Corrections: Driven by cosmetic appeal and the desire for independence from corrective lenses, this segment sees continued innovation and demand for procedures like LASIK and PRK.
- Glaucoma: The rising incidence of glaucoma and the demand for effective IOP-lowering treatments ensure sustained growth for laser therapies like Selective Laser Trabeculoplasty (SLT) and Transscleral Cyclophotocoagulation (TSCP).
- Diabetic Retinopathy: With the global surge in diabetes, laser photocoagulation remains a cornerstone treatment for diabetic retinopathy, driving demand for diode and multifocal lasers.

Challenges in the Ophthalmic Lasers Industry Market
Despite its growth trajectory, the ophthalmic lasers market faces several challenges. High upfront costs associated with advanced laser systems can be a barrier for smaller clinics and emerging markets. Stringent regulatory approvals for new technologies and devices can lead to lengthy market entry timelines. Reimbursement policies by healthcare payers can also impact the adoption rates of new procedures. Moreover, the need for highly skilled ophthalmic surgeons to operate these sophisticated devices necessitates continuous training and education, posing a challenge in certain regions. The competitive intensity among manufacturers, driving down prices for established technologies, also presents a dynamic challenge.

Key Milestones in Ophthalmic Lasers Industry Industry
- June 2022: Iridex Corporation received regulatory clearance from China's National Medical Products Administration (NMPA) for its Cyclo G6 platform, enabling non-incisional IOP control for glaucoma treatment in a significant emerging market.
- April 2022: Lumibird Group launched the Capsulo Nd: YAG laser, a versatile platform enhancing efficiency and accuracy for capsulotomy and iridotomy treatments.
